Vengeance Racing custom Twin Turbo C6 Z06 build
I posted this over on CorvetteForum and thought you guys might enjoy this as well...
We will be posting dyno results later today... So far we have tuned the waste gates as well as 14.5psi settings. On the gates making 5.5psi we produced 690rwhp/660rwtq On 14.5psi on pump gas we produced 913rwhp/834rwtq Tomorrow we will see what C16 and 20+psi nets ...We just got all of the parts back from the coater this morning. I figured I would post up some pics for all to see. The car- C6 Z06 Corvette Modications:
Turbonectics T66 Turbos JGS500 Wastegates JGS TK300 Blow off Valves TurboWerx Exa Scavenge Pump Bell Intercooler Core End Tanks Fabricated by Vengeance Racing Fuel Injector Connection F IC1000 Fuel Injectors AMS 1000 Boost Controller with C02 Complete/Custom Fuel System All Fabrication/Installation by Vengeance Racing Turbos will be mounted by the bellhousing. We are using C6 manifolds that have been fully ported/coated. Our last turbo build produced 1008RWHP @5800rpm using smaller turbos and a stock LS7 block. That particular car is currently being upgraded to an RHS block/All Pro Headed Solid roller 434 and we will turn up the boost and make some GOOD power!!! This combo should easily see 1100RWHP on a conservative tune. Pics below.
